Sara J. Felten is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Genetics and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Sara J. Felten has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 962 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Molecular Biology, 6 papers in Genetics and 5 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Sara J. Felten’s work include Glioma Diagnosis and Treatment (6 papers), Brain Metastases and Treatment (3 papers) and Radiomics and Machine Learning in Medical Imaging (3 papers). Sara J. Felten is often cited by papers focused on Glioma Diagnosis and Treatment (6 papers), Brain Metastases and Treatment (3 papers) and Radiomics and Machine Learning in Medical Imaging (3 papers). Sara J. Felten collaborates with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and Spain. Sara J. Felten's co-authors include Jan C. Buckner, Paul D. Brown, Karla V. Ballman, Robert M. Arusell, Edward G. Shaw, Caterina Giannini, Mark E. Law, Robert B. Jenkins, Heather C. Flynn and Sandra Passe and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Cancer Research and Cancer.
